As a System Integration and Test Engineer, the individual will be responsible for the seamless integration and rigorous testing of complex systems to ensure they meet all specified requirements and performance standards. This role involves coordinating with multiple engineering teams to integrate hardware and software components, developing and executing comprehensive test plans, and troubleshooting any issues that arise during the integration process.
The engineer will utilize expertise in system engineering principles, test methodologies, and diagnostic tools to validate system functionality and reliability. Additionally, they will document test results, provide detailed reports, and work closely with stakeholders to ensure successful project outcomes. A strong background in systems integration, thorough understanding of testing protocols, and excellent problem‑solving skills are essential for success in this role.
You will prepare materials, document, and present technical designs internally and customer facing.
Essential Functions- System Integration
- Lead the coordination with multiple engineering teams to integrate hardware and software components into a cohesive system.
- Ensure the seamless integration of all system components, aligning with overall system design and functionality.
- Test Plan Development
- Develop comprehensive and detailed test plans and procedures to thoroughly validate system performance and reliability.
- Design and optimize test cases to cover all functional and non‑functional aspects of the system.
- Execution of Testing
- Oversee and conduct the execution of test plans and procedures, methodically verifying that the system meets all specified requirements.
- Utilize both manual and automated testing techniques to assess the system’s performance under various conditions.
- Troubleshooting and Problem Resolution
- Lead the identification, diagnosis, and resolution of issues encountered during the integration and testing phases.
- Collaborate closely with development teams to implement fixes and ensure that defects are resolved efficiently.
- Documentation and Reporting
- Document test results comprehensively, providing detailed reports on findings, including defects, performance issues, and compliance with requirements.
- Maintain meticulous records of test activities and outcomes, ensuring all documentation is up‑to‑date and accurate.
- Collaboration and Communication
- Communicate test results and project status effectively to stakeholders, including engineers, project managers, and customers.
- Ensure all stakeholders are informed of any issues and the steps being taken to address them, fostering transparency and trust.
- Compliance and Standards Adherence
- Ensure all testing activities comply with relevant industry standards, regulations, and internal quality assurance protocols.
- Stay informed about best practices and emerging trends in the field, applying this knowledge to improve testing processes.
- Continuous Improvement
- Evaluate existing testing processes and methodologies, implementing improvements to enhance efficiency and effectiveness.
- Introduce innovative testing techniques and tools to stay ahead of technological advancements.
- Risk Management
- Identify potential risks early in the integration and testing phases and develop mitigation strategies to minimize their impact.
- Proactively address risks to ensure the smooth progression of the project.
- Technical Leadership
- Provide technical leadership and mentorship to junior engineers and team members, fostering their professional growth.
- Share expertise and best practices, supporting the team in overcoming technical challenges and advancing their capabilities.
- Overall System Validation
- Conduct end‑to‑end system validation to ensure all components and subsystems work together as intended.
- Perform stress testing, performance testing, and other types of validation to ensure system robustness and reliability.
